ABSTRACT A new population of Platanthera lacera is reported for Vernon Parish, southern Louisiana RESUMEN 5e cita una nueva poblacion de Platanthera lacera de Vernon Parish, Surde Louisiana. Green fringed orchid (Platanthera lacera (Michx.) G. Don) was reported for Loui- A siana as early as 1852 by Riddell (1852). specimen was collected in Shreveport in Caddo Parish by MacRoberts in 1976 (MacRoberts 1977). Apparently this specimen was misidentified and not included in the orchid flora of Louisiana Thomas by Prigeon and Urbatsch and excluded by and Allen This (1977) (1993). was MacRoberts and MacRoberts species reinstated the Louisiana flora by to Caddo (1998); the authors also stated that the site for the collection in Parish was now^ housing development. Green fringed orchid reported from of a is all NRCS (USDA, the eastern United States except for Florida 2005). In Texas, this & orchid reported only from Bowie County (Correll 1947; Liggio Liggio 1999). is swamps The habitats reported orchid include open sedge and for this swampy marshes, bogs, meadows, and glades of open woods, w^oods and wet or occasionally dry open fields and prairies, and in thickets (Correll 1978; Liggio & Com- North America Liggio 1999; Radford 1968). In Flora of Editorial et al. swamp from sphagnum and mittee (2002), this species reported bogs, alluvial is stream banks, riparian meadows, sand moist and seeping slopes, forests, flats, and borrow According prairies, roadside banks, ditches, old fields, pits. to Liggio and Liggio (1999), this orchid has a preference for acidic soils but indifferent is and to varying conditions of moisture, sunlight, shade. On May new was 2005, population of green fringed orchid discovered a 6, in Vernon Parish, Louisiana which ca 150 miles south of the Caddo I^arish is location and apparently the southernmost location in the United States. Vernon along edge mowed hunting edge pasture Piirish: oi trail, oi SW and bccch/whuc oak forest in Section 14 T2S R7W, GPS N30.942 W93.053, ca. 1/4 mi of Tiilbert- NW Pierson Cemetery (Pine Grove Church) and ca. 5 mi of Sugartown \w drainage of unnamed creek Whiskey 24 May A\kn that drains into Chitto Creek, 2005, ci al /94/.5, (BRIT, Port Vo\k Herb., Ul.M). mowed The habitat varied from an open trail to the dense edge of the beech/ white oak forest of the creek edge and frorn rnoderatcly well drained to moist soil. The soil type is Gore which is a very line sandy loam with 5 to 12 percent The slopes (Soil Survey Staff 2003). elevation \n the area ranges from 150 to 160 The plants had begun flower on May seemed peak around May just to to feet. 6, and very few flowers were noted on June 2005. 20, just a 11, During May was and clumps 2005, the revisited several times 35 of the site orchid were noted; most clumps had single flowering stem but few had two a a flowering stems. The area surrounding each of the 35 clumps was examined and the five nearest individuals w^re identilied including herbaceous, wood) J vine, shrub (wocody non-vines shorter than six shrubs/saplings (woody feet), J non-vines taller than six feet and five inch or less dbh), and trees (woodv non- vines taller than six feet and larger than 5 inch dbh) species (Table The per- 1). cent of each species out ol the 175 total individuals (five times 35) for each cat- egory listed in Table for the herbaceous and woody vines only one percent is 1; reported tor each species and lor the woody non-vine species, the per- is first cent listed the shrub, the second the shrubs/saplings, and third the is is is trees. The surrounding was examined twenty and area for a distance of feet all asso- m A ciated species were identified and listed Table total of 124 species from 1. 90 genera and 56 families were identified as a nearest individual or associated species. Densiometer readings were taken at each clump and the average cover percent was 61.04% and ranged from 43.03% 75.00%. to common The most occurring herbaceous was nearest species Chas,manthi[im and was scssiliflorum Yates (17.71%) followed by (Poir.)
